Mahindra New Bolero: Still Tough, Now Classy

Set to launch in early 2025, the Mahindra New Bolero is all about smart evolution. It retains its legendary boxy silhouette, a shape that Indian drivers trust. But look closer, and you’ll see the refinements — sharper body lines, chrome-accented front grille, and brand-new LED projector headlamps that bring a more premium feel.

Mahindra is also breaking away from its old-school palette by introducing vibrant new color options like Sunset Orange and Deep Forest Green, along with the timeless white and silver. It’s no longer just a rugged workhorse — it now turns heads too.

Interiors: Where Comfort Meets Practicality

Inside the Mahindra New Bolero, things have taken a significant leap forward. The new dashboard design is more ergonomic, and the inclusion of a 7-inch touchscreen infotainment system supporting Android Auto and Apple CarPlay finally brings the Bolero into the connected car age.

The seats now come with tougher, stain-resistant fabrics, and the cabin feels more spacious thanks to better design and smarter use of materials. A boot space of 690 litres ensures that it’s ready for anything from family trips to heavy-duty errands.

Engine: The Dhansu Upgrade

Here’s where the Mahindra New Bolero really flexes its muscles. It will come equipped with a powerful 2.2L mHawk diesel engine expected to deliver 130-140 bhp and 300 Nm of torque. Paired with either a 6-speed manual or a 6-speed automatic transmission, it’s a game-changer for performance lovers.

Safety and Tech: Practical Yet Progressive

For the first time, the Bolero feels truly modern in terms of safety. All variants will come with:

  • Dual front airbags
  • ABS with EBD
  • Rear parking sensors
  • ISOFIX child seat mounts

Higher trims offer disc brakes on all wheels, hill-hold assist, and even tyre pressure monitoring — making the Mahindra New Bolero not just safe, but smart.

Mahindra has smartly added useful features without overwhelming users with tech gimmicks. Expect BS6-compliant engines, offline navigation, LED lighting, and an optional terrain management system — a rare treat in this price bracket.

Variants & Price: Value Like Never Before

The Mahindra New Bolero will be available in three trims: B4, B6, and B6 (Opt). Prices are expected to start at around ₹10 lakh and go up to ₹12.5 lakh (ex-showroom). Yes, that’s a bit more than the outgoing version, but with everything new it packs, it’s completely worth it.

VariantKey FeaturesExpected Price
B4Basic features, manual AC₹10 lakh
B6Power windows, central locking, digital MID₹11 lakh
B6 (Opt)Touchscreen, dual airbags, reverse camera₹12.5 lakh

Quick Tech Specs

SpecificationDetails
Engine2.2L mHawk Diesel / 1.5L mHawk75 (lower trims)
Power OutputUp to 140 bhp
TorqueUp to 300 Nm
Transmission6-Speed Manual / Automatic
Mileage16–17 kmpl
Seating7-Seater (2+3+2)
Boot Space690 litres
Drive TypeRear-Wheel Drive
